Sample Registration Technician
Job Description
The Sample Registration Technician accurately receives, registers, and tracks incoming laboratory samples while maintaining meticulous records for quality control and regulatory purposes. This role enters sample data into laboratory information management systems, supports the laboratory testing process by verifying and submitting results, and follows established quality system documents and procedures. The technician helps maintain a clean, safe, and efficient workspace and may have the opportunity to train into microbiology laboratory work based on performance.
Responsibilities
+ Receive and register incoming samples from the shipping department, ensuring accurate identification and documentation for each sample.
+ Maintain a neat, organized, and accurate record system of daily work, including information needed for quality control tests and regulatory requirements.
+ Enter sample data into DQCI LIMS or Eurofins eLIMS systems, either manually or through automatic export, ensuring data integrity and completeness.
+ Verify sample information and testing results for accuracy prior to submission.
+ Submit results, either electronically or in hard copy, to the appropriate personnel for laboratory testing and reporting.
+ Understand, follow, and apply Quality System documents, including the Quality Manual,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s), and Methods relevant to sample registration and handling.
+ Adhere to quality measures and procedures to meet or exceed ISO/IEC standards, government regulatory requirements, and internal company quality expectations.
+ Handle samples using proper aseptic techniques to prevent contamination and ensure reliable test results.
+ Perform routine cleaning of glassware, vials, and workstations to maintain a safe, orderly, and efficient work environment.
+ Support sample management, handling, preparation, receiving, and registration activities in a fast-paced setting.
+ Communicate effectively with team members to coordinate workflow, resolve issues, and maintain pace with sample volume.
+ Follow all laboratory safety guidelines and practices while working in the sample receiving area and, if trained, in the microbiology laboratory.
+ Demonstrate reliability and strong work ethic by consistently meeting attendance, performance, and quality expectations.

Work Environment
This role is based 100% in the sample receiving area, which operates similarly to a shipping department where milk samples from dairy producers are received and entered into the system. The environment is fast paced, with a small team of approximately three people working closely together and relying on strong communication to keep up with sample volume. Start times will alternate between 5:00 a.m., 6:00 a.m., and 7:00 a.m. depending on the assigned area, and the technician typically maintains the same start time for an entire week.
The schedule includes rotating roughly one Saturday per month, with a weekday off during that same week to balance hours. Over time, and based on performance, there may be opportunities to train and work in the microbiology laboratory, splitting time between sample receiving and microbiology testing.
